<?php for ($i=1;$i<=10;$i++){?> <a href="#" class="test"><?php echo $i; ?></a> <?php } ?>
求高人指点,我在点击第一个超链接时它会变色,点击第二个超链接时,第二个会变色,第一个又变回来的js函数,以此类推,谢谢了...
求高人指点,我在点击第一个超链接时它会变色,点击第二个超链接时,第二个会变色,第一个又变回来的js函数,以此类推,谢谢了
展开
3个回答
展开全部
以下使用JQUERY插件的
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
</head>
<script type="text/javascript" src="http://ajax.aspnetcdn.com/ajax/jQuery/jquery-1.6.2.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$("#links a").click(function(){
$("#links a").each(function(i,dom){
$(dom).removeAttr("style");
});
$(this).attr("style","background-color:#F00");
});
});
</script>
<body>
<div id="links">
<a href="javascript:;">1111111</a><br />
<a href="javascript:;">2222222</a><br />
<a href="javascript:;">3333333</a><br />
<a href="javascript:;">4444444</a><br />
<a href="javascript:;">5555555</a><br />
<a href="javascript:;">6666666</a><br />
<a href="javascript:;">7777777</a><br />
<a href="javascript:;">8888888</a><br />
</div>
</body>
</html>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
</head>
<script type="text/javascript" src="http://ajax.aspnetcdn.com/ajax/jQuery/jquery-1.6.2.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$("#links a").click(function(){
$("#links a").each(function(i,dom){
$(dom).removeAttr("style");
});
$(this).attr("style","background-color:#F00");
});
});
</script>
<body>
<div id="links">
<a href="javascript:;">1111111</a><br />
<a href="javascript:;">2222222</a><br />
<a href="javascript:;">3333333</a><br />
<a href="javascript:;">4444444</a><br />
<a href="javascript:;">5555555</a><br />
<a href="javascript:;">6666666</a><br />
<a href="javascript:;">7777777</a><br />
<a href="javascript:;">8888888</a><br />
</div>
</body>
</html>
展开全部
<script type="text/javascript">
function change_color(a) {
var all_a = document.getElementsByTagName("a");
for(n = 0; n < all_a.length; n++) {
all_a[n].style.color = '#f00';
}
a.style.color = '#0a0';
}
</script>
<?php
for ($i=1;$i<=10;$i++){
echo "<a href=\"#\" class=\"test\" onclick=\"change_color(this); return false;\">$i</a> ";
}
?>
function change_color(a) {
var all_a = document.getElementsByTagName("a");
for(n = 0; n < all_a.length; n++) {
all_a[n].style.color = '#f00';
}
a.style.color = '#0a0';
}
</script>
<?php
for ($i=1;$i<=10;$i++){
echo "<a href=\"#\" class=\"test\" onclick=\"change_color(this); return false;\">$i</a> ";
}
?>
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询